Why did Dio hate rainbow in the dark?
“Rainbow in the Dark” is about an inability to release tremendous potential, and Dio once said it was inspired by his time fronting Black Sabbath. Ronnie wanted to cut “Rainbow in the Dark” from the album, thinking it was too poppy and didn’t belong on the album.

Did Dio play with Deep Purple?
In 1975, Deep Purple guitarist Ritchie Blackmore founded the band Rainbow and hired Dio to be his lead singer; during his tenure, the band released three studio albums. Dio quickly emerged as one of heavy rock’s pre-eminent vocalists.

What voice is Dio?
The Vocal Range Of Ronnie James Dio: (F1-)C♯2-G5(-A6) Description: Ronnie is widely recognized for his powerful low tenor voice, and it often assumed that he has a very large range to go with it. While it is true that he does, he almost always only sings at a register between D4 and D5.
Does Dio spell devil?
When the “DIO” logo is viewed upside-down it can be interpreted as spelling either the word “DIE” or “DEVIL”. Ronnie James Dio has called this purely coincidental.

What killed Ronnie James Dio?
Stomach cancer
Ronnie James Dio/Cause of death
The heavy metal singer, Ronnie James Dio, has died at the age of 67. He had been suffering from stomach cancer. Dio was best known for fronting Black Sabbath after the departure of Ozzy Osbourne, but he was also involved in the bands Elf, Rainbow, Heaven & Hell and Dio during a career stretching over 53 years.

When did Rainbow leave the band Black Sabbath?
Rainbow recorded two more studio albums with Dio—Rising (1976) and Long Live Rock ‘n’ Roll (1978)—before Dio left the band to join Black Sabbath in 1979. Rainbow’s early work primarily featured mystical lyrics with a neoclassical metal style, then went in a more pop-rock oriented direction following Dio’s departure from the group. [1]
What did Toto say at the end of over the Rainbow?
The recording features the customary introduction to a Rainbow show – the classic quote from The Wizard of Oz, “Toto: I have a feeling we’re not in Kansas anymore. We must be over the rainbow!” with the last word repeated as an echo, then the actual band plays a musical phrase from the song ” Over the Rainbow ” before breaking into “Kill the King”.
